Specific Entry Criteria

  • Minimum age: 16 years
  • Minimum qualification: 60 credits in Te Reo Māori at level 4 on the NZQF or established equivalency

Assessment tests: 

  • Applicants will need to sit an assessment test to ensure that they are enrolled at the correct level. Note: An inability to answer any questions will not exclude an applicant from the programme. It will only be used to ensure correct level placement.

In addition to meeting admission requirements, applicants must meet the English Proficiency Outcomes as stated below in accordance with the NZQF Programme Approval and Accreditation Rules 2013, if you first language is not English or you come from a country where the language of instruction is not English and you are enrolling as a permanent resident.

  • IELTS test – Academic score of 5.5 with no band score lower than 5
  • TOEFL Paper-based test (pBT) – Score of 550 (with an essay score of 5 TWE)
  • TOEFL Internet-based test (iBT) – Score of 60 (with a writing score of 20)
  • University of Cambridge ESOL examinations – FCE, or FCE for schools, or CAE, or CPE with a score of 169. No less than 162 in each skill
  • NZCEL – Level 4 with the Academic endorsement
  • Pearson Test of English (Academic) – PToE (Academic) score of 50
  • City & Guilds IESOL – B2 Achiever with a score of 66
